Finding the Heating Element in an Amana Dish washer.
The burner is usually located at the end of the bathtub. To access it:.
Open the dish washer and eliminate the lower shelf.
Find the coiled steel aspect near the base.
Unscrew or unclip any safety panels covering the element.
Make sure the power is off prior to proceeding. Aesthetically check the element for splits, rust, or staining-- these are indications it needs substitute.
Removing the Faulty Burner.
To remove the burner:.
Turn off the power and supply of water.
Access the bottom of the dishwasher (you might need to move it out from under the counter).
Separate the cables affixed to each end of the heating element.
Loosen the installing nuts safeguarding the element in position.
Carefully pull the component out with the inside of the dish washer.
Check for indicators of damages that may describe performance concerns, such as warping, scaling, or burn marks.
Setting Up a New Heating Element.
As soon as the old heating element is gotten rid of:.
Move the brand-new heating element into location inside the tub.
Straighten it with the mounting openings and secure it making use of nuts or braces.
Reattach the electrical wiring below, making sure each terminal is securely linked.
Recover power and test for correct operation.

Testing the Dishwashing Machine Post-Installation.
After mounting the new heating element:.
Plug in the dishwashing machine and recover power at the breaker.
Run a normal cycle with a thermometer to validate the water warms correctly.
Pay attention for the component engaging during the cycle and inspect the sanitation and dry skin of the dishes at the end.

Usual Heating Element Issues That Affect Cleaning.
When your recipes appear unclean or moist, the heating element may not be getting to the essential temperature level. Typical issues include:.
Mineral buildup-- Hard water down payments can layer the aspect and minimize its performance.
Thermostat malfunction-- If the thermostat does not activate the burner, water won't warm effectively.
Electrical failure-- Broken wires or terminals might protect against present from reaching the component.
Regular evaluation and cleaning of the burner can prolong its lifespan and boost cleansing performance. If these concerns continue, professional maintenance is advised.

Frequently Asked Questions: Typical Amana Dishwashing Machine Issues.
Q: Exactly how do I understand if my Amana dish washer's burner misbehaves?
A: If your meals are constantly appearing dirty or wet, and the water does not really feel hot, the heating element may be damaged. Utilize a multimeter to examine for connection.
Q: How much does it set you back to change a heating element in an Amana dish washer?
A: The part itself generally costs $30--$ 60, with labor adding an additional $100--$ 150 if you hire a professional.
Q: Can I run my Amana dishwasher without a working burner?
A: Technically, yes, but your recipes may unclean or dry effectively, and you'll risk bacterial buildup from unheated water.
